Eligibility Criteria for Ph.D. in Pharmacy at NIMS University
Prospective candidates must satisfy the following minimum requirements:
- Master’s degree (M.Pharm, MSc Pharmacy, or equivalent) with at least 55% aggregate marks (or 5.0 CGPA on a 10‑point scale).
- Nationally recognized university degree; foreign degrees must be NOC‑certified.
- Qualifying score in the NIMS University Ph.D. entrance examination or exemption based on GATE/CSIR‑NET scores.
- English proficiency (for international students) – minimum TOEFL 79 or IELTS 6.0.
Entrance Exam for Ph.D. in Pharmacy at NIMS University
The entrance examination evaluates the candidate’s foundational knowledge and research aptitude. Key sections include:
- Pharmaceutical Chemistry & Biochemistry – 30 marks
- Pharmacology & Pharmaceutics – 30 marks
- Research Methodology & Statistics – 20 marks
- General Aptitude & Logical Reasoning – 20 marks
Applicants with valid GATE (Pharmacy) or CSIR‑NET scores are exempted from the written test and proceed directly to the interview stage.

Admission Process for Ph.D. in Pharmacy at NIMS University
- Online application submission through the university portal.
- Upload scanned copies of academic transcripts, degree certificates, and proof of identity.
- Pay the non‑refundable application fee (₹2,500).
- Appear for the entrance exam (or submit GATE/CSIR‑NET scores for exemption).
- Qualify for the personal interview and research proposal presentation.
- Receive the admission offer letter and complete enrollment by paying the first-year fee.

NIMS University Ph.D. Syllabus for Pharmacy
The syllabus is structured into three phases:
- Coursework (Year 1) – Core modules: Advanced Pharmaceutical Chemistry, Biostatistics, Research Ethics, and Elective Topics.
- Comprehensive Examination (End of Year 1) – Written test covering all core subjects.
- Research Thesis (Years 2‑4) – Proposal approval, experimental work, data analysis, manuscript preparation, and defense.

Scholarship for Ph.D. in Pharmacy at NIMS University
NIMS University provides several merit‑based and need‑based financial aids:
- University Merit Scholarship – 25% tuition waiver for top 10% rankers.
- Research Grant Scholarships – Up to ₹1,00,000 per annum for projects funded by CSIR, DST, or industry partners.
- STTP (Short‑Term Training Programme) Stipends – Fixed monthly stipend of ₹15,000 for the first two years.
- External Fellowships – Opportunities to apply for ICMR, DBT, or WHO fellowships.
FAQs Regarding Ph.D. in Pharmacy at NIMS University
- Q1: Can I pursue a Ph.D. in Pharmacy after a B.Pharm degree?
- A: Yes, candidates with a B.Pharm (55%+) may enroll directly after clearing the entrance exam, though a master’s degree is preferred.
- Q2: What is the typical duration of the Ph.D. program?
- A: The full-time program spans 3–4 years, depending on research progress and publication requirements.
- Q3: Is there a provision for part‑time Ph.D.?
- A: NIMS University offers a part‑time mode for working professionals, extending the duration to a maximum of 6 years.
- Q4: Are there opportunities for collaborative research with industry?
- A: Yes, the university has MoUs with leading pharma companies, allowing students to work on sponsored projects.
- Q5: How many publications are required for thesis submission?
- A: At least two papers in indexed journals (Scopus/Web of Science) are mandatory before the final viva‑voce.
